22 хв читання
30 Mar
30Mar

Що таке фреймворк і навіщо він потрібен?

Фреймворк (англ. framework – "каркас") – це готова структура або набір правил, які допомагають систематизувати роботу, уникати хаосу та прискорювати процеси. 

Він може бути технічним (як у програмуванні) або концептуальним (як у менеджменті чи особистому розвитку).


Чому фреймворки так популярні?


  1. Економія часу – не потрібно винаходити колесо.
  2. Стандартизація – усі учасники процесу розуміють правила гри.
  3. Гнучкість – можна адаптувати під конкретні потреби.
  4. Менше помилок – структура допомагає уникати критичних недоліків.

Фреймворки в IT: Швидкість і якість

У світі програмування фреймворки – це основа розробки. 

Вони надають готові модулі для створення сайтів, додатків або сервісів, дозволяючи розробникам зосередитися на унікальних функціях, а не на базовому коді.


Топ-3 фреймворки для IT:


  1. React.js – для створення динамічних веб-додатків.
  2. Django – потужний інструмент для back-end розробки на Python.
  3. Flutter – для крос-платформенної мобільної розробки.

Приклад: 

React.js дозволяє створити інтерактивний інтерфейс за лічені години, тоді як без фреймворка це зайняло б дні або тижні.

Фреймворки в проектному управлінні: Від хаосу до системи

Управління проектами – це постійна боротьба з дедлайнами, бюджетами та командною роботою. Фреймворки допомагають організувати процеси так, щоб усі етапи були прозорими та контрольованими.


Топ-3 фреймворки для проектів:


  1. Scrum – ідеально підходить для гнучкої розробки продуктів.
  2. Kanban – візуалізація робочих процесів для максимальної ефективності.
  3. PRINCE2 – структурований підхід для складних проектів.

Приклад: 

Scrum розбиває роботу на спринти, що дозволяє швидко адаптуватися до змін і отримувати результат кожні 2-4 тижні.


Фреймворки для повсякденних задач: Особиста ефективність

Фреймворки стали невід'ємною частиною сучасного життя в багатьох сферах, включаючи управління проектами, коучинг та повсякденну ефективність. 

Вони надають структуровані підходи до виконання задач, допомагаючи особам та командами покращити свою продуктивність.

Що таке фреймворк?

Фреймворк в простому розумінні – це набір структур, методів і принципів, які забезпечують базу для досягнення цілей. Наприклад, можна порівняти його з архітектурою будівлі: без надійного каркасу (фреймворку) важко побудувати міцний та функціональний продукт.

Використання фреймворків у повсякденних задачах

Фреймворки можуть бути використані для організації повсякденних задач, що значно підвищує їхню ефективність. Завдяки заздалегідь побудованій структурі ви зможете заощадити час на плануванні і більше часу присвятити виконанню справ.


1. Методологія SMART

Найбільш відомий підхід до формулювання цілей – це SMART. Він дозволяє формувати задачі, які є:

  • Specific (конкретні)
  • Measurable (вимірні)
  • Achievable (досяжні)
  • Relevant (актуальні)
  • Time-bound (встановлені у часі)

Застосування методології SMART забезпечує чітке фокусування на ключових аспектах, що допомагає уникнути розпорошення зусиль.


2. Принципи «Трьох важливих задач»

Цей фреймворк покликаний допомогти вам зосередитися на трьох найважливіших завданнях на день. Це дозволяє уникнути перевантаження та зосередитися на пріоритетах. Кожного ранку ви визначаєте три задачі, які потрібно виконати, і це стає вашою дорожньою картою на день.


3. Операційні матриці

Для управлінців та тим, хто відповідає за планування задач, корисно використовувати операційні матриці, такі як матриця Ейзенхауера. Ця матриця допомагає розподілити задачі за критерієм важливості та терміновості, що забезпечує ефективне використання ресурсів і часу.

Фреймворки в управлінні та коучингу

Фреймворки не лише підвищують ефективність у повсякденному житті, але й є важливими інструментами в управлінні та коучингу.

1. Модель GROW

Ця модель, що стоїть за цілями, реальністю, варіантами і волею, є потужним інструментом для коучера. Вона допомагає оцінити поточний стан клієнта (реальність), сформулювати цілі ( Goals), визначити можливі варіанти досягнення цілей та допомогти клієнту мобілізувати свою волю на дії.

2. Scrum і Agile у проектному управлінні

Хоча ці фреймворки стосуються більше управління проектами, вони також можуть бути адаптовані для повсякденних задач. Наприклад, короткі спринти та щоденні стендапи можуть бути застосовані і в особистому контексті: ви можете встановити цілі на тиждень і щодня перевіряти прогрес.

Висновок

Фреймворки є надзвичайно корисними інструментами для підвищення особистої ефективності. Вони надають чіткий базис для планування, виконання задач і досягнення цілей. 

Підходячи до роботи з фреймворками індивідуально (вибираючи ті, які відповідають вашим потребам найбільше), ви зможете підвищити свою продуктивність.

Коментарі
* Адреса електронної пошти не відображатиметься на сайті